Apex Legends player recreates Borderlands intro cutscene in the game

A Borderlands fan has recreated the intro cutscene from the game using Apex Legends characters.

u/McArctico shared the video on Reddit (via PC Gamer) that features the Legends and their finishers set to Elephant’s Ain’t No Rest for the Wicked, and it's perfect.

A lot of comments call out the OP for their "Bloodhound bias", and other suggestions have included adding the characters' voice lines, although that last one doesn't have everyone on board, with other commentors pointing out that the Borderlands intro doesn't include any dialogue.

Borderlands got a re-release with the launch of the Game of the Year Edition last week, and you can check out a comparison video between the the original and the remaster to see how it stacks up.

Borderlands 3 is launching this September for PC and console, although the six-month timed exclusivity on the Epic Store hasn't gone down particularly well with fans. The series as whole was review-bombed on Steam - even Telltale's Tales' Tales From the Borderlands.

Apparently cross-platform support is "being looked at" but we'll get more details on the launch during the May 1 reveal event.

Borderlands 3 is out September 13 on PC, PS4, and Xbox One.
